Especificações

Atributo Valor
Package Tape & Reel (TR),Cut Tape (CT)
ProductStatus Active
AmplifierType Instrumentation
NumberofCircuits 1
OutputType Rail-to-Rail
SlewRate 5V/µs
-3dbBandwidth 2 MHz
Current-InputBias 0.5 pA
Voltage-InputOffset 2 mV
Current-Supply 415µA
Current-Output/Channel 48 mA
Voltage-SupplySpan(Min) 2.5 V
Voltage-SupplySpan(Max) 5.5 V
OperatingTemperature -55°C ~ 125°C
MountingType Surface Mount
Package/Case 8-TSSOP, 8-MSOP (0.118, 3.00mm Width)

Application

The INA332AIDGKR is a precision instrumentation amplifier often used in applications requiring accurate differential signal amplification. Key application areas include medical instrumentation, such as ECG and EEG machines, where precise low-level signal amplification is crucial. It's also employed in industrial process controls for sensor signal conditioning, ensuring accurate data acquisition. Additionally, the amplifier is suitable for strain gauge and pressure transducer interface, enhancing the accuracy of measurements. Its low power consumption and high precision make it ideal for battery-powered and portable devices. Overall, the INA332AIDGKR is versatile for any application needing precise and reliable amplification of small differential signals.
